Inspector Notes

This inspection was conducted by licensing staff using an alternate remote protocol, including telephone contacts, documents review, and a virtual tour of the program.

A monitoring inspection was initiated and concluded on 10/18/2021. The provider was contacted by telephone and a virtual inspection was conducted. There were 7 children present (21points), ranging in ages from 5months to 4years, with the provider and one assistant caregiver supervising. The Inspector reviewed compliance in the areas of administration, physical plant, staffing and supervision, programming, special care and emergencies and nutrition. A total of 2 children's records and 3 caregiver/adult household member records were reviewed.

The information gathered during the inspection determined no violations with applicable standards or law. No violations were issued.

Standard 22VAC40-111-180-A
Based on a review of health records, it was determined that the provider did not obtain for each caregiver and adult household member a current Report of Tuberculosis Screening form, in accordance with the requirements in 22 VAC 40-111-170, every two years from the date of the first screening.
Evidence:
At the start of this inspection the provider was not home. The children were in care with the assistant caregiver and one adult household member who acts as an assistant caregiver when needed. The TB screening for this adult household member expired on 8/19/2020.
Plan of Correction: I made her an appointment for a repeat TB screening on Nov. 8.
